THE POSITION
The City of Santa Barbara Library Department is seeking a motivated and dynamic Library Technician specializing in Youth Services. Library Technicians help create a welcoming and engaging environment for all Library visitors. They actively support the promotion of library services and resources and contribute to a positive user experience.
Key responsibilities include:
Providing excellent customer service to patrons of all ages and backgrounds from any service post in the Library or Library Outreach Van.
Preparing content for informational handouts, flyers, and social media posts for public distribution both in print and online.
Creating and maintaining eye-catching book displays and book lists to promote Library materials and programs.
Assisting in the planning and implementation of a wide range of innovative Library programs and community education events, including Early
Literacy programming, STEAM activities, teen programs, the all-ages Summer Reading Program, and cultural performances.
Supporting the circulation, organization, and maintenance of materials within the library collection.
Training and mentoring Library volunteers.
Monitoring, ordering, and receiving Library supplies; maintaining inventory records and files for equipment and supplies.

Distinguishing Characteristics
This is the full journey level class within the Library Technician series. Employees within this class are distinguished from the Library Assistant series by the performance of the full range of duties assigned including assisting in the acquisition and cataloging of library materials. Employees at this level receive only occasional instruction or assistance as new or unusual situations arise, and are fully aware of the operating procedures and policies of the work unit. This class is distinguished from the Senior Library Technician in that the latter plans, directs and leads a unit or department within the library.

Knowledge of:
- Library services and functions.
- Library terminology.
- Practices and techniques of library material classification and cataloging.
- Computerized cataloging, bibliographical and circulation system databases.
- Library equipment and tools including personal computers, Internet, CD readers, indices, microfilm/fiche readers and printers.
- Principles and procedures of record keeping.
- English usage, spelling, grammar and punctuation.
- Modern office procedures, methods and computer equipment.
Ability to:
- Perform a variety of journey level technical and clerical library work.
- Operate computerized cataloging, bibliographical and circulation system databases.
- Keyboarding speed necessary for successful job performance.
- Understand and follow oral and written instructions.
- Work independently in the absence of supervision.
- Communicate clearly and concisely, both orally and in writing.
- Establish and maintain effective working relationships with those contacted in the course of work.
- Supervise the work of volunteers and employees.
- Perform routine reference searches.
- Maintain physical condition appropriate to the performance of assigned duties and responsibilities:
- Sitting or standing for long durations
- Operating assigned equipment
EXPERIENCE AND TRAINING GUIDELINES
Any combination of experience and training that would likely provide the required knowledge and abilities is qualifying. A typical way to obtain the knowledge and abilities would be:
Experience:
Two years of technical and clerical library experience including the acquisition, cataloging, and circulation of a variety of library materials.
Education and/or Training:
Equivalent to the completion of the twelfth grade.
License, Certificate and/or Other Requirements:
May require possession of a California driver's license.
Bookmobile assignment requires possession of a Class B California driver's license.
